Pegboards
Pegboards are a versatile storage solution that can help you keep your tools and materials within easy reach. You can use hooks and bins to hang everything from paintbrushes to scissors, keeping your workspace clutter-free and organized.

Shelving Units
Shelving units are essential for maximizing vertical storage space in your garage. They can hold everything from paint cans to canvases, allowing you to keep your materials organized and easily accessible. Look for sturdy, adjustable shelving units that can be customized to fit your needs.

Plastic Bins
Plastic bins are perfect for storing smaller items like beads, buttons, and other crafting supplies. Labeling your bins can help you quickly find what you need, making your DIY projects more efficient and enjoyable.

Mason Jars
Mason jars are a cute and practical way to store smaller items like paintbrushes, pens, and markers. You can hang them on a pegboard or attach them to a wooden board for easy access and a touch of rustic charm.

Tool Chests
A tool chest is a must-have for any DIY artist. It can safely store your power tools, hand tools, and other equipment, keeping them organized and protected. Look for a tool chest with multiple drawers and compartments to keep everything in its rightful place.

Hooks and Racks
Hooks and racks are essential for hanging larger items like bicycles, ladders, and extension cords. They can help you free up floor space and keep your garage tidy and organized. Look for heavy-duty hooks and racks that can support the weight of your items.
